Output 80f606a1624a183c500c74aa243e3394a6b8ad484bf2d5240bfabe9acbfea25c:0

value
2348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b6d8071647081c06a4ea391211b0cb44fa0630 OP_EQUAL
address
31wNK99v7392spm9FPQqLz4eniV2NsWCgV
transaction
80f606a1624a183c500c74aa243e3394a6b8ad484bf2d5240bfabe9acbfea25c
confirmations
180831
spent
true